14:22 — Ops at Varnholt confirmed two Fernwick build agents drifted 41 seconds apart; NTP sync had been disabled during a kernel patch. Signed artifacts from agent-pool B carried timestamps predating their source commits, tripping the provenance verifier. All B-pool artifacts quarantined pending re-sign. No evidence of tampering; skew was operational. Security review should treat any timestamp-only anomaly from this window as benign after cross-checking. The affected run is identified by the trace token below.

session token of tajef-bageg = htk21_5d90d574934f3ccae6437

**Ticket FWU-882: Lumenpad devices stuck on old firmware**

Support folks — a handful of Lumenpad units aren't picking up the 3.1 firmware because the update channel keeps handing them a cached manifest. Workaround: have the customer reboot twice, which forces a fresh channel check. Fix lands in the next channel-service deploy. The affected build is identified by the token below.

pipeline stamp: htk31_f769b577b3028a4e9958e5bb8d1259a

## Further reading

So, the flaky DNS thing in the Brindle mesh: resolutions to the Oakmere auth service intermittently time out, and retries mask it until they don't. We suspect the resolver cache in the sidecar, not upstream. Worth reviewing from a security angle since failover currently falls back to a less-validated endpoint. The full investigation log, packet captures, and fallback config review live on the internal page here.

wiki page, bagaf-fawip: https://harbor.tolvaqsys.local/pages/repo/pages/secrets/eac969ffc71f356b

Management Meeting Minutes — Reseller Programme

Present: Dena Forsgate, Ollie Rennick, Priya Calloway.

Quick recap: the Fernlight reseller programme is tracking ahead of plan — 14 partners signed versus the 10 we'd hoped for. Margins are a bit thinner than modelled, mostly down to the tiered discount we offered early joiners. Ollie will tighten the discount bands before the next intake. Where we want to take the programme next is covered in the note below.

board note of yahip-tadug: Headcount on the Zorath team goes from 9 to 100 by the end of April. Gross margin on Zorath came in at 10 percent against a plan of 20 percent.